2012 Chrysler 200 review
I have 265k on this.I bought the lifetime warranty so everything good Replaced ac unit 2 times cost me 100.00 both times. No other major things. Brakes,tires and oil I pay for. Drove 90 hiway miles for work round trip starting when I got the car,new. Bunch of long trips,held up very good,but after about 6 hours seats stopped being comfortable.

2012 Chrysler 200 review
Just recently bought this car with only 38000 miles on it. It was a one owner car and very well taken care of. However, I only had this car less than 3 months and already, I had to replace the battery and put in a new alternator and taken care of 2 recalls on it. It has been in the shop more than I have had it at home. Did I buy a lemon? Who knows? However, I want my Honda Accord back.

2012 Chrysler 200 review
The 3,6 V6 is very powerful and performs extremely well. I experienced "0" body roll and cornering was exceptional. Very big trunk with top up. Car ride is quiet and solid at every speed. I absolutely recommend the Limited Trim. Very reasonable wind noise with top up. This is a front wheel drive convertible, after all.

How much does the 2012 Chrysler 200 cost?
The 2012 Chrysler 200 price depends on several factors, including the trim level, optional features, mileage, vehicle history and location. The nationwide average price for a 2012 200 is $6,578, with pricing starting at $685.
Is the 2012 Chrysler 200 reliable?
The 2012 Chrysler 200 has an average reliability rating of 4.3 out of 5 according to Cars.com consumers. Find real-world reliability insights within consumer reviews from 2012 200 owners.
